Junk removal vs dumpster in Moss - Which is good for you?
For those who have a project you're going to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your rubbish and crap for you, or in the event you need to just rent a dumpster in Moss and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ative in the event you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you don't m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also work well in case you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ll-offs generally start at 10 cubic yards, so if you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for a lot more dumpster than you need.
Garbage or rubbish removal makes more sense if you'd like another person to load your old things. In addition, it works well if you'd like it to be taken away immediately so it's out of your own hair or in case you simply have a few big things; this is likely c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.
Do I need a license to rent a dumpster in Moss?
If that is your first time renting a dumpster in Moss,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. If your plan is to put the dumpster completely on your own property, you're not usually required to obtain a license.
If, however, your job requires you to place the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this may often mean that you have to apply for a license. It's almost always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(perhaps the parking enforcement division) if you own a question concerning the need for a license on a street.
If you fail to get a license and discover out afterwards that you were required to have one, you will prob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ster in Moss c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?
Picking a dumpster size requires some educated guesswork. It is often problematic for people to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they have no idea how much stuff their roofs feature.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make the ideal choice.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you'll probably require a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.
In case you are working on residential roofing project,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can usually exp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ely need a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of people order one size larger than they think their jobs will require since they would like to avoid the extra exp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ters that were not large enough.
A few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ster
Although the special rules that control what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of materials that most dumpster service in Mosss will not permit. A number of the things that you generally cannot place in the dumpster contain:
Batteries, particularly the type that feature m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other chemicals that may dam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that feature batteries There are also some mattresses that you can generally place in your dumpster so long as you are willing to pay an added f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it's better to get in touch with your rental business to get a list of stuff which you can't place into the dumpster.
